What Is a Google Business Profile?

A Google Business Profile (GBP) is a free listing that allows businesses to manage how they appear in local search results and map listings. Offered by Google, its purpose is to help customers quickly find accurate information about a business and connect with it easily.

A business profile can appear in search results, map listings, and the local business section shown when users look for nearby services.

A profile typically displays:

  • Business name

     

  • Address and location

     

  • Contact number

     

  • Website link

     

  • Business hours

     

  • Reviews and ratings

     

  • Photos and updates

     

  • Services or products

     

This tool is useful for local businesses, service providers, freelancers, agencies, and any company that wants to attract customers from a specific area.

7. Provides Valuable Business Insights

The profile also provides performance data, including:

  • Number of calls received

     

  • Direction requests

     

  • Website visits

     

  • Search queries used to find the business

     

These insights help businesses understand customer behavior and improve marketing decisions.

Common Mistakes Businesses Make with Google Business Profile

Many businesses create a profile but fail to manage or optimize it properly, which limits visibility and reduces customer trust. Since the profile is managed through services provided by Google, keeping information accurate and updated is essential for attracting customers.

Not Claiming or Verifying the Profile

Some businesses never claim or verify their listing, which means they cannot control or update their business information, leading to missed opportunities.

Incorrect Business Information

Outdated or incorrect details such as address, phone number, or business hours can confuse customers and cause them to choose competitors instead.

Ignoring Customer Reviews

Failing to respond to customer reviews, especially negative ones—can harm reputation and make the business appear inactive or unprofessional.

Not Updating Photos or Posts

Profiles without photos or regular updates appear inactive and less trustworthy. Fresh images and posts help maintain customer interest and improve engagement.

Avoiding these mistakes helps businesses gain better visibility and build stronger customer trust.

Tips to Optimize GBP for Better Results

Optimizing your Google Business Profile helps improve local visibility and attract more customers. Since the platform is provided by Google, keeping your profile complete and regularly updated ensures your business appears trustworthy and active in search results.

Complete Every Profile Field

Fill in all available details, including business description, services, categories, contact details, and operating hours. Complete profiles rank better and build customer confidence.

Add High-Quality Images

Upload clear and professional images of your business location, services, products, and team. Quality visuals attract attention and improve engagement.

Collect and Respond to Reviews

Request reviews from satisfied customers and respond politely to every review to maintain a positive business reputation. Active review management builds trust.

Post Regular Updates and Offers

Share announcements, offers, events, or updates regularly to keep your profile active and encourage customer interaction.

Keep Business Details Updated

Always update contact information, operating hours, and services whenever changes occur to avoid confusing potential customers.

Regular optimization helps maintain strong visibility and increases customer inquiries over time.
